Franklinton Alderman Seat in Limbo

A Washington Parish Clerk of Court spokesperson has advised that a determination will be made tomorrow (November 10) whether or not a runoff will be necessary for a Town of Franklinton Alderman seat.  The runoff would pit candidates Darwin Sharp against Doug Brown and would be on the December 10 ballot.
Ten candidates for Aldermen vied for five seats on the Board of Aldermen in the November 8 election. The Louisiana Secretary of State unofficial returns reflect the five candidates with the most votes as:  T.J. Butler (685 votes), Patrice Crain (664 votes), John Daniel (624 votes), Heath Spears (616 votes), and Darwin Sharp (552 votes).  Doug Brown is shown as having received 549 votes.
